Examples Of Zero Property Of Multiplication
Examples Of Zero Property Of Multiplication. Even if it’s 1,000,000,000 x 0 the product, or answer, will still be a zero. Which of the following is an example of zero property of multiplication?

Even if it’s 1,000,000,000 x 0 the product, or answer, will still be a zero. According to the closure property, if two integers \(a\) and \(b\) are multiplied, then their product \(a×b\) is also an integer. What is the zero property of multiplication?
5 × 0 = 0.
Here are a few examples of the zero property of multiplication. 3×0=0 −5×0=0 we conclude that x×0=0. 5+0=5 5 x 0=0 when we add the zero doesn’t do anything.
